Tomahawk Community Bank promotions
Friday, December 23, 2011
Tomahawk Community Bank recently
announced several promotions. Kathy Rankin has been named President and CEO.
She started her career at the bank when it was known Tomahawk Savings and Loan
as a teller in 1977. She received the banking operations specialist designation
with the institute of financial education and graduated from the Graduate
school of Banking at UW-Madison.
Jean Zoellner has been named Vice
President of Finance and Audit. She started her career with the bank in 1989,
and has worked in many different areas. She recently graduated from the
Graduate School of Banking at UW-Madison.
Audrey Cordova was named Vice President of Operations. She
came to TCB in 1995 with previous experience. She was promoted to Senior Loan
Officer in 2002.
Finally Shelly Cole was promoted to Senior Loan Officer. They
said her previous real estate experience was an asset when joining the team.
She has extensive knowledge and experience in the residential mortgage area
including the secondary market and reverse mortgages.
